In recent years, there has been a growing recognition within organizations that they need a designated individual who has the
necessary skills to effectively address information security responsibilities. Consequently, the role of the CISO has emerged as
an executive-level position, obtaining the information security responsibilities that previously were held by personnel within the IT
Department. Now, organizations have a dedicated professional focused on overseeing and managing all aspects of information
security, ensuring a more comprehensive and specialized approach to safeguarding information and information assets.

The “PECB Chief Information Security Officer exam meets the requirements of the PECB Examination and Certification Program
(ECP). It covers the following competency domains:
Duration: 3 hours
Location: Online through the PECB app OR in person in one of the PECB exam centers
Preparation: PECB Exam Preparation Guides
Language: The exam is available in multiple other languages and does not need to be taken in the same language as the training material. Additional time can be requested when your native language is not available in your mother tongue (to be requested by candidates on the exam day)
Retake: In case you fail the exam, you can retake it within 12 months following the initial attempt for free

After successfully passing the exam, you can apply for one of the credentials shown below. You will receive the certificate once you comply with all the requirements related to the selected credential.
The requirements for PECB Chief Information Security Officer certifications are as follows:
| Credential | Exam | Professional experience | CISOMS project experience | Other requirements |
| PECB Certified Information Security Officer | PECB Chief Information Security Officer exam | None | None | Signing the PECB Code of Ethics |
| PECB Certified Chief Information Security Officer | PECB Chief Information Security Officer exam | Five years: Two years of work experience in information security | Project activities: a total of 300 hours | Signing the PECB Code of Ethics |
